The Artist: Alan Majchrowicz

Wilderness photographer Alan Majchrowicz is fortunate to be able to combine his passion for the outdoors with his profession. Born and raised in the Midwest, Alan studied photography and painting at The Art Institute of Chicago. Responding to the call of the wild Pacific Northwest in 1980, he moved to Washington state. Since then he has hiked, backpacked, and driven throughout the region, using a large format camera to photograph spectacular land and seascapes. Alan also works in the studio photographing flowers, shells and an assortment of natural objects. His images capture the perfection and fragility of objects found in nature and serve to remind us of our human impact upon the natural environment. "Producing images which inspire and move the viewer" is both Alan's goal and his reward for his life's work. Alan's photographs have been exhibited throughout the Northwest and are included in private and public collections. He is also represented through stock agencies and corporate art dealers. His images have appeared as posters, greeting cards, in advertising campaigns, calendars, and many national magazines including Backpacker, Country Journal, and US News & World Report.

Wild Apple, based in beautiful Woodstock, Vermont is one of the world’s leading and best known publishers renowned, in particular, for it's floral imagery and the work of artist Cheri Blum.

Wild Apple has long recognized the importance of not only finding great artists but then nurturing and directing these artists to produce work which reflects both the artists individuality and the latest trends in colour, style and home decoration.
